如何使用 HTML 创建地图元素和引用外部 API?

html css JavaScript
2023-05-04 17:47:04 发布

使用HTML创建地图元素和引用外部API可以通过以下步骤实现:

  1. 首先,需要在HTML页面中添加一个地图元素。可以使用<div>标签来创建一个容器,并使用CSS设置容器的宽度和高度。例如:
<div id="map" style="width: 100%; height: 500px;"></div>
  1. 接下来,需要引用一个外部的地图API。例如,使用Google Maps API可以通过在<head>标签中添加以下代码来实现:
<script src="https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Y"></script>

注意:要使用Google Maps API,需要先在Google Cloud Console中创建一个项目,并生成一个API密钥。

  1. 然后,在页面加载完成后,需要使用JavaScript代码初始化地图并添加标记。可以使用以下代码:
<script>
  function initMap() {
    var map = new google.maps.Map(document.getElementById('map'), {
      zoom: 8,
      center: {lat: -34.397, lng: 150.644}
    });
    var marker = new google.maps.Marker({
      position: {lat: -34.397, lng: 150.644},
      map: map,
      title: 'Hello World!'
    });
  }
</script>
  1. 最后,在<body>标签中添加一个<script>标签并调用initMap()函数来初始化地图。例如:
<body onload="initMap()">
  <div id="map" style="width: 100%; height: 500px;"></div>
  <script src="https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Y"></script>
</body>

总结

使用HTML创建地图元素和引用外部API可以通过以下步骤实现:

1. 在HTML页面中添加一个地图元素,使用

标签来创建一个容器,并使用CSS设置容器的宽度和高度。

2. 引用一个外部的地图API,例如,使用Google Maps API可以在标签中添加相应的代码。

3. 在页面加载完成后,使用JavaScript代码初始化地图并添加标记。

4. 在标签中添加一个